Отключите запятую в Excel Field

Одно из наших веб-приложений дает пользователям способность добавить несколько объектов к нашей базе данных с помощью файла CSV. Чтобы сделать это, они вводят свои объекты в шаблон Excel и затем экспортируют в CSV.

Однако большинство конечных пользователей не понимает, что, если они помещают запятые в поле "Description", оно смешивает с форматированием экспортируемого файла CSV, вызывая ошибки при попытке добавить объекты к базе данных.

Я обычно просто анализировал бы через CSV в бэкенде веб-приложения, но в моем случае я не могу просто вынуть запятые по очевидным причинам.

Там какой-либо путь состоит в том, чтобы отключить использование запятых () прямо в Excel Template? Как форматирование столбца?

1
задан 05.04.2011, 18:45

1 ответ

Поля Excel с запятой в них экспортируются с кавычками, окружающими их.

Ваш импорт CSV должен обработать эти кавычки для обеспечения импорта полей с запятыми в них.

Большинство языков имеет модуль импорта CSV, который делает это для Вас.

1
ответ дан 17.12.2019, 00:22

Теги

Похожие вопросы